📜 The Origin of the “Sgian Dubh”

The term Sgian Dubh (Gaelic for Black Knife) carries a deep historical meaning:

  • Early versions were often carved from black bog wood, giving rise to its name.

  • Another theory suggests it refers to the concealed nature of the blade — hence the tradition of wearing it openly in the Highland stocking to show friendship and peace.

The Sgian Dubh was never meant as a weapon but as a ceremonial and practical accessory, essential to traditional Highland dress.
